Spectacular Spring Holiday Spots

Much of Australia’s spectacular scenery truly comes into its own during Spring, with many bulbs and blossoms blooming and signalling the start of summer.

NSW

At the Blue Mountains, a stone’s throw from Sydney, visitors can marvel at the floral finery at many of the local towns and villages. The Leura Garden Festival is one such example, proudly showcasing the local azaleas, rhododendrons, dogwoods, camellias and other cool climate exotics, as well as flowering annuals, perennials and bulbs. QLD

A great spot to explore in springtime is the Whitsundays – one of the jewels in Queensland’s crown, comprising 74 island wonders. There are plenty of caravan parks to choose from, ensuring you have the best stay possible. Airlie Beach, the tropical hub of The Whitsundays, is jam-packed with restaurants, bars, boutique shops and the infamous Airlie Beach lagoon.

Further afield, top activities in the region include hiking, snorkelling, trips to the Great Barrier Reef and more! At this time of year, there are fewer jellyfish in the region [peak season runs November – May], which makes for a more seamless trip. Be sure to always carry vinegar with you and consult local medical advice to ensure a safe trip, whatever time of year.

NT

This is also an excellent time to head into the Red Centre if you live in the Northern Territory. Whilst notoriously hot, the pre-summer season is a reasonable temperature – with the mercury hovering below 30 degrees centigrade. The native flora – comprising over 400 different plants – also puts on an impressive display at this time of year, which you won’t want to miss.

WA

If you live in WA, Spring is the perfect time to visit Margaret River. The famous wine region is located in the south-west corner of Western Australia. The town is not only known for its world class wineries, but also its stunning beaches and surf breaks. Now is the best time for whale watching. If you’re lucky enough, you’ll get an up close and personal view of the whales as they return to Margaret River’s warm waters during Springtime.

SA

There’s so much to see and do at Kangaroo Island during Spring. The South Australian region is home to some of the country’s most stunning flora and fauna. During Spring, Kangaroo Island transforms into a feast for the senses with beautiful wildflowers and native plants in full bloom. If you’re lucky enough, you’ll spot some amazing wildlife creatures. From hiking, kayaking and fishing to mountain biking and exploring the incredible Remarkable Rocks, the list of activities to do at Kangaroo Island is endless!

VIC

If you live in Victoria and when travel is permitted, do yourself a favour and book a week away at Wilsons Promontory National Park this Spring. It is one of the most beautiful places to visit in Victoria. If you visit during Spring, you will experience the magnificent displays of wildflowers including orchids, wattle and heathland. Wilsons Prom is also home to some of the country’s most spectacular beaches and a host of native wildlife animals including emus, kangaroos, wombats and echidnas.
